    Description
    VisionSpring, an international social enterprise, was founded in 2001 with a mission to broaden access to affordable eyewear everywhere.

    We establish market access to eyeglasses and vision correction for people living in poverty so that they may enhance their livelihoods, learning, and quality of life.

    Summary

    This role is a contract-based, full-time position for the initial period of one year.

    As with other contractors with whom we have worked for many years, we expect the successful candidates to be willing to be long-term contractors for VisionSpring.

    About Us

    We are creating access to affordable eyewear, everywhere. Clear vision creates opportunities for increased learning, work, safety, civic participation, and quality of life.
    As a social enterprise, social change motivates us first.

    Our focus on sales and revenue targets serves and advances our mission objective—to increase functioning, productivity, and income earning potential for our low-income consumers by correcting refractive error with eyeglasses.

    We are working to transform the systemic dysfunction of an optical market that has failed to deliver eyeglasses—a 700-year-old technology—to 2.5 billion consumers in need of vision correction, most of whom live on less than $4 a day.

    We serve low-income consumers, not as beneficiaries but as customers.

    Our customers expect a high-quality and affordable product, and they will spend limited discretionary income for the immediate and tangible benefits of vision correction.

    By selling eyeglasses, we awaken new demand and seed a viable market.

    By selling new eyeglasses we are able to serve four times as many people per dollar input than the alternative of donating recycled ones.

    To efficiently scale, we must deliver each new unit with lower cost.
    We run our business on both sales metrics and social impact measures. We exploit a range of organizational forms and practices to get the job done.
    We believe in scaling our impact, not our organization. We are a lean team of doers.
